Njaksimvol’ vs Hoyvík/ Tórshavn Climate & Distance Between

Faroe Islands flag
  • The distance between Njaksimvol’, Russia and Hoyvík/ Tórshavn, Faroe Islands is approximately 3,343 km or 2,077 mi.
  • To reach Njaksimvol’ in this distance one would set out from Hoyvík/ Tórshavn bearing 58.7°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Njaksimvol’ bearing 120° or ESE .
  • Njaksimvol’ has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Hoyvík/ Tórshavn has a subpolar oceanic climate (Cfc).
  • The annual average temperature is 8.4 °C (15.1°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 31 °C (55.8°F) more in Njaksimvol’.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 880.9 mm (34.7 in) less which is equivalent to 880.9 l/m² (21.62 US gal/ft²) or 8,809,000 l/ha (941,741 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.4° lower in Njaksimvol’ than in Hoyvík/ Tórshavn.
